Robert Maurice (Bob) Coon, 91

Born January 14, 1934 in Plainfield, WI to Raymond Maurice and Nellie Marie Coon. He passed away peacefully on March 22, 2025.

Bob graduated from Plainfield High School and attended the University of Wisconsin School of Agriculture. He served in the US Army, stationed primarily in Huntsville, AL at the Red Stone Arsenal. Upon discharge from the Army, he returned to Madison, WI and worked as a drafting technician at Gisholt Machine Company. When the company left Madison, he worked for the City of Madison Engineering Department until he retired at age 62.

On January 5, 1963, Bob married Mara Kraule. They lived on the Northeast side of Madison where they raised their two sons, James and David. He was an active participant in their extracurricular activities. He coached Little League for many years. He helped engineer pinewood derby cars with his boys.

He loved to be a part of his kids and grandkids lives. He was an avid bowler, hunter, fisherman, boater, golfer and gardener. He always enjoyed supplying neighbors and friends with produce from his well-maintained garden. He was always happiest at their cottage in Northern Wisconsin and on Little Spider Lake.
